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a steel bundle which does not cause dew condensation and allows to visually observe the fitting depth of a threaded bar and manufacturing method therefor. SOLUTION: This steel bundle 10 comprises a bundle height adjusting fittings 10, an upper threaded bar 20, a lower threaded bar 30, a sleeper fittings 40, and a supporting plate 50. The bundle height adjusting fittings 10 has a frame shape and comprises an upper portion 11 having a threaded hole 14, a lower portion 12 having a threaded hole 15, and two parallel intermediate portion 13 extending between the upper portion 11 and the lower portion 12. The bundle height adjusting fittings 10 is produced by heating a law material for bar and splitting and widening the heated bar from the split line in the middle portion.

2. Description of the Related Art Conventionally, wooden bundles have been used for floor bundles that have been subjected to large-scale pulling. However, in order to prevent floor noise caused by deformation due to drying of the wood, the bundle has a bundle height adjusting function. In addition, steel bundles have been used to prevent termite damage. As a specific example of a conventional steel bundle,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open
-82159, a steel bundle disclosed in Japanese Utility Model Laid-Open No. 6-185.
No. 31 discloses a steel bundle and the like. JP-A-10-82
No. 159 discloses a steel bundle in which two bent portions are formed on the upper and lower portions of a flat adjustment metal fitting so as to be displaced in the longitudinal direction, and the inner peripheral surface thereof is threaded to form two bent portions. One of the screw at the bent portion and the screw at the two lower bent portions is left-handed and the other is right-handed. The upper screw is screwed to the upper screw, and the lower screw is screwed to the lower screw. .
Further, the steel bundle disclosed in Japanese Utility Model Laid-Open No. 6-18531 has an upper threaded rod and a lower threaded rod which are threaded into a pipe-shaped adjusting bracket having a left-hand thread on one of the upper and lower parts of the pipe and a right-hand thread on the other. It is a combination.

The conventional steel bundle has the following problems. The steel bundle disclosed in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open No. H10-82159 has a structure in which a screw is provided only on a half circumference and the remaining half circumference is open. Therefore, when a compressive load is applied to the steel bundle,
The thread is susceptible to stress that tends to move away from the threaded rod,
Problems such as deformation of the screw portion, separation of the screw from the screw rod, and the like occur. In the steel bundle disclosed in Japanese Utility Model Laid-Open No. 6-18531, since the adjusting bracket is a pipe, the fitting depth of the threaded rod cannot be visually checked, and there is a possibility that dew condensation or rust may occur inside. S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ION An object of the present invention is to provide a steel bundle and a method for manufacturing the same, in which the thread portion has sufficient strength, the fitting depth of the threaded rod is visible, and there is no risk of dew condensation or rust inside.

In the method for producing a steel bundle described in (1) to (6) and the method for producing a steel bundle described in (7) to (10), since the bundle height adjusting bracket has a frame shape, the upper threaded rod and the lower A threaded rod extends into the space between the two longitudinal extensions in the middle of the bundle height adjustment fitting to allow visual inspection of the insertion depth of the upper and lower threaded rods. In addition, the upper and lower screws of the bundle height adjustment bracket are drilled and cut on the inner circumference, so the screws are all over the circumference, the strength of the thread is large, the thread is deformed, Never leave. In the method for manufacturing a steel bundle according to the above (2) and the method for manufacturing a steel bundle according to the above (7), the frame-shaped bundle height adjusting bracket heats the material rod and then moves the intermediate portion in the longitudinal direction of the rod along the axis. Since it is formed by splitting it to the left and right, the yield is good, the cost is low, and the productivity is excellent, as compared with a steel material pressing method or shaving. In the method for manufacturing a steel bundle according to the above (3) and the method for manufacturing a steel bundle according to the above (8), since the vertical ribs extending in the axial direction are formed on the outer surface of the bundle height adjusting bracket, the bundle height adjusting bracket is not used. The operability when adjusting the bundle height by rotating it around the shaft center is good, and a dedicated tool is not required, and the strength is improved (about 14% improvement).

The operation of the bundle height adjusting bracket 10 according to the embodiment of the present invention will be described. Construction is performed in the following procedure. First, steel bundle 1
Is placed on the floor concrete under the large pulling, and the lower surface of the large pulling and the large receiving metal fitting 40 are bonded (temporarily fixed) with the double-sided tape 41, and then the bundle height adjusting metal fitting 10 of the steel bundle 1 is turned by hand. After adjusting the supporting force, large undersize fitting 4
0 is fixed with four nails. Finally, the bundle fixing lock nuts 60 and 61 are tightened. The support plate 50 of the steel bundle 1 and the floor concrete are often fixed with an adhesive, but may be fixed with bolts. When it is necessary to adjust the bundle height by floor noise or floor height adjustment after construction, lock nuts 60 and 61 are required.
The upper threaded rod 20 and the lower threaded rod 30 are loosened, and the bundle height adjusting bracket 10 is turned to the right or left.
The bundle height changes due to the relative expansion and contraction through 0, and after the adjustment is completed, the lock nuts 60 and 61 are tightened again.

Then, as shown in FIG. 4, the method of manufacturing the bundle height adjusting metal fitting 10 is to cut a bar material having ribs 61 and 62 into a material bar 101 having a predetermined length.
0, a step 110 in which the raw material rod 101 is conveyed to a heating step by a conveyor and heated to 1000 to 1100 ° C. by a gas heating furnace 111 or the like; Blade 12 at the middle part in the direction
1 and two parallel longitudinally extending portions 13 extending longitudinally between the upper portion 11 and the lower portion 12 and between the upper portion 11 and the lower portion 12 by pressing and spreading left and right along the axis.
a frame-shaped body 12 comprising an intermediate portion 13 having a (the intermediate portion 13 may have a connecting portion 13b shown in FIG. 3 in the middle).
A step 120 of manufacturing the frame-shaped body 122 and a step 130 of conveying the frame-shaped body 122 to the upsetting forging step by a conveyor and upsetting and forging the upper part 11 and the lower part 12 of the frame-shaped body 122 to form a head having a predetermined shape. , Drill 143 on the upper part 11 of the frame 122
A hole 141 that penetrates in the axial direction is formed by using a tap 144 on the inner periphery of the hole 141 using a tap 144.
4 and a drill 1 in the lower part 12 of the frame 122.
A step 140 of making a hole 142 penetrating in the axial direction at 43 and cutting the other screw 15 of either the right-handed screw or the left-handed screw on the inner periphery of the hole 142 to manufacture the bundle height adjusting bracket 10. Step 140 is a dedicated automatic line. In step 140, there are drills and taps on the left and right sides, and upper 11 and lower 12
Drilling and tapping are performed on the left and right simultaneously. The cross section of the material rod 101 is circular, and the cross section of the longitudinally extending portion 13a is substantially semicircular.

Then, the bundle height adjusting bracket 10 is moved to step 15
At 0, it undergoes a final quality inspection, is packed at step 160, and is transported or shipped to the next step. The outer surface of the bundle height adjusting metal fitting 10 is usually plated (for example, galvanized). If plating (eg galvanized) is applied,
The plating step 135 is provided after the upsetting forging step 130 and before the screw drilling step 140 (in this case, the screw is raised after plating, so that the screw portion is not plated) or the screw turning is performed. It is provided after the step 140 (in this case, the screw portion is plated and then the screw portion is also plated). In the plating step 135, the frame-shaped body 122 is placed in the plating tank (hot-dip galvanizing tank) 1
61, and is subjected to (zinc) plating.
